Soothing Crawl Alleviation for Dogs: Reasons & Ways
That persistent itchy skin on your canine can be a significant source of Itch relief dogs distress for both of you! Common sources of this discomfort range from fleas and sensitivities to food, pollen, or bathing products, and even dryness of the skin. Addressing the underlying issue is key, but immediate soothing can often be achieved through soaks with a sensitive cleanser, skin ointments, or a simple cool compress. Always see your animal doctor to identify the problem and establish a lasting approach for keeping your furry friend comfortable and scratch-free.

Addressing Itchy Puppies: Stopping and Treatment Guidance
A lot of people with dogs experience the problem of an scratchy puppy. It could be due to multiple factors, including reactions, parasites, bacterial issues, or dry skin. To prevent discomfort, consistent grooming with a gentle cleanser is essential. Think about allergy testing to determine the underlying reason of the discomfort. For treatment, OTC antihistamines or ointments might offer relief. But, it’s important to see your veterinarian for a proper diagnosis and specific recommendations – especially serious discomfort or inflammation.
